Abstract

An extraction of the 1798 census of 101 of the 106 German colonies established along the Volga River. A translation from the original manuscripts (created by the Saratov Province Financial Ministry), now in the St. Petersburg Russian Archives. The American Historical Society of Germans from Russia translated and published them 1995-1996. Includes census of the population, economy, and agriculture. A gazetteer is included of the colonies as they existed at the time. Movement tables are also included, showing movement within the colonies.
